Approaches for optimizing audio preprocessing stacks for minimal distortion and maximal downstream benefit.
A practical guide examines layered preprocessing strategies, balancing noise reduction, reverberation control, and spectral preservation to enhance downstream analytics, recognition accuracy, and perceptual quality across diverse recording environments.
Effective audio preprocessing stacks begin with a clear understanding of the target downstream tasks. Whether the aim is speech recognition, speaker identification, or acoustic event detection, preprocessing choices set the foundation for all subsequent analysis. The first step is to assess the typical recording conditions: sample rate, dynamic range, microphone quality, and ambient noise profiles. By mapping these variables to performance metrics, engineers can design modular stages that address specific issues without over-processing. Prioritizing transparency, configurability, and auditability helps teams tune parameters responsibly, ensuring that improvements in signal cleanliness translate into measurable gains in model robustness and generalization across unseen data.
A balanced approach to noise suppression avoids the trap of over-filtering. Aggressive denoising can strip away subtle spectral cues essential for distinguishing phonemes, while insufficient filtering leaves behind artifacts that degrade model learning. The goal is to apply adaptive filters that respond to instantaneous SNR fluctuations and preserve spectral transients critical for intelligibility. Techniques such as multi-band spectral gating, Wiener filtering, and beamforming when using microphone arrays can be combined with perceptual weighting to minimize distortion. It is important to validate results with objective metrics and human listening tests to ensure that the perceived audio quality aligns with the optimization goals of downstream models.
Alignment between preprocessing and model expectations reduces inefficiency and distortion.
Modular pipeline design starts with a clear separation of concerns. Each preprocessing module should have a single responsibility, such as noise reduction, dereverberation, or sample rate conversion, and expose tunable parameters. This approach enables rapid experimentation without cascading side effects. The design should also embrace reproducibility: fixed random seeds, versioned configurations, and deterministic processing paths. Observability is essential, too, including meaningful logging and traceability so that upstream choices can be correlated with model performance outcomes. By documenting the rationale behind each module, teams create a resilient framework that adapts to evolving data regimes while maintaining a transparent record of decisions.
In practice, evaluating the effectiveness of a preprocessing stack requires robust benchmarking. Curate representative datasets that reflect real-world variability, then measure downstream metrics such as word error rate, speaker verification accuracy, or event classification F1 scores. Employ ablation studies to quantify the contribution of each module under diverse conditions, including low-SNR and highly reverberant environments. Visual inspections of spectrograms can reveal artifacts invisible to quantitative metrics, guiding targeted improvements. It is also prudent to monitor latency and compute cost, since real-time or edge deployments impose constraints that influence the feasibility of certain algorithms. The outcome should be a reliable, scalable pipeline with predictable behavior.
Data-driven evaluation informs where distortion harms downstream tasks most.
Aligning preprocessing with model needs begins with understanding the features extracted downstream. If a model relies on log-mel spectrograms, preserving mid- to high-frequency structure and minimizing phase distortion becomes critical. Conversely, for raw waveform models, maintaining waveform integrity may take precedence. Establishing a mapping from raw input characteristics to feature space helps identify where concessions are permissible and where fidelity must be preserved. This alignment also informs the choice of sample rate, frame length, and hop size. Engaging data scientists early in the design process ensures that signal processing choices complement the architecture, training regime, and evaluation criteria.
Establishing constraint-driven defaults improves cross-project consistency. For example, setting a baseline noise reduction level that remains stable across sessions reduces performance drift caused by environmental changes. Similarly, defining maximum allowable dereverberation strength prevents unnatural timbre shifts that confuse models. These defaults should be accompanied by clear calibration procedures, so operators can adjust for unusual environments without compromising baseline integrity. Regular revalidation against updated benchmarks helps ensure that the preprocessing stack remains aligned with evolving model capabilities and deployment contexts, sustaining reliability over time.
Real-time feasibility and resource constraints shape practical decisions.
A data-centric mindset focuses on how each processing decision affects model inputs. Small alterations in spectral content, temporal envelopes, or phase can cumulatively influence classification boundaries or recognition margins. By instrumenting experiments that isolate distortion sources, teams can quantify tolerances and set tolerance thresholds. It is beneficial to track both objective audio quality metrics and end-to-end performance metrics, then analyze discrepancies to identify hidden interactions. This approach reveals whether perceived improvements translate into measurable gains, guiding iterative refinements that push the overall system toward robust, maintainable performance across diverse usage scenarios.
Iterative refinement thrives on controlled experiments and clear hypotheses. Each hypothesis should articulate a specific expectation about how a preprocessing adjustment will influence downstream results. For instance, hypothesizing that mild dereverberation improves intelligibility in distant speech can be tested across rooms with varying reverberation times. After collecting results, synthesize findings into actionable updates to the pipeline, documenting the rationale and any trade-offs. Over time, this disciplined cycle yields a preprocessing stack that adapts to new domains while preserving core capabilities, rather than drifting due to ad hoc optimizations.
Practical guidelines reconcile distortion control with downstream benefit.
Real-time constraints demand careful attention to latency budgets and computational budgets. Choosing lightweight algorithms or implementing streaming variants of heavier methods can keep dashboards responsive and devices capable. Trade-offs between accuracy and speed must be negotiated, often by adjusting frame sizes, algorithmic complexity, or approximation techniques. In edge deployments, memory footprint and power consumption become critical factors, dictating hardware choices and parallelization strategies. A thoughtful design anticipates these constraints from the outset, avoiding costly redesigns later when the system must scale to larger user bases or stricter latency requirements.
Efficient pipelines also benefit from hardware-aware optimizations and parallelism. When feasible, offload intensive tasks to dedicated accelerators, exploit SIMD capabilities, and batch-process multiple channels for multi-microphone setups. Careful scheduling minimizes cache misses and reduces data movement, which are common culprits of slowdowns. While speed is essential, it should not come at the expense of signal fidelity. Documentation of performance targets and test results ensures teams can reproduce gains and justify architectural choices during deployments or audits.
A holistic guideline set begins with a clear definition of success metrics that reflect downstream impact. Beyond sharp objective scores, include perceptual tests, downstream task accuracy, and end-user satisfaction where applicable. Establish a governance process for balancing competing objectives, such as preserving timbre versus suppressing noise, so decisions are transparent and justified. Maintain an up-to-date inventory of preprocessing configurations and their effects on model behavior, enabling rapid rollback if a deployment reveals unintended side effects. Regular reviews, cross-team communication, and documentation cultivate a culture of disciplined experimentation that yields durable improvements.
Concluding, the most effective audio preprocessing stacks are those that integrate feedback loops, rigorous validation, and principled trade-offs. By designing modular, task-aware pipelines, aligning with model expectations, and prioritizing data-driven evaluation, teams can minimize distortion while maximizing downstream benefits. Real-time considerations and resource constraints should inform every choice, ensuring practicality across devices and environments. The result is a resilient preprocessing framework that not only enhances current performance but also adapts smoothly to future developments in speech technology, acoustic sensing, and human-centered audio analytics.